The possible relatives of Terrell are Billy R Layton, Daisy M Layton, Otha C Layton and 3 other people. Terrell's birth date was listed as 1950. Terrell was born 75 years ago. 1822 Curtis Dr, North Augusta, Sc 29841 is where Terrell lives. Other a city that he has stayed in is Mobile. The number currently linked to Terrell is (803) 441-8199.